Important  before purchase:

  • Visually inspect the original Occupancy Sensor (OCS) connector. Ensure it has three wires: Red, White, and Brown. This is crucial for vehicles produced during model year transitions (e.g., 2007 or 2015), as different versions may exist. The OCS sensor itself has a 3-wire configuration with red, white, and brown wires on its plug. It is vital to verify compatibility. Please note that the wire colors on the car's side of the connector may differ from those on the OCS sensor side. Refer to the connector image and its location in our product gallery for visual guidance

  • Ensure your vehicle's airbag issue has been correctly diagnosed. Airbag360 emulator specifically resolves fault codes indicating a passenger occupancy sensor malfunction B1018 / B1019

Installation Instructions:

  1. Turn OFF the ignition. Locate and disconnect the original occupancy sensor connector (3-pronged) under the passenger seat.
  2. Connect the Airbag360 emulator to the original sensor plug.
  3. Turn ON the ignition and start the vehicle.

In most cases, the Airbag warning light will turn OFF automatically after installation.

However, in some instances, you may need to clear stored fault codes, depending on how long the malfunction was present and where the code was saved in the vehicle's memory.

We will also provide you with instructions on how to manually erase fault codes and how to disable the seatbelt reminder light that may be triggered by the occupied signal sent by the emulator.

Airbag360 emulator simulates an occupied seat- therefore, the airbag will be armed, and the car will prompt you to fasten your seatbelt.

Pro tip: If your airbag light is still on after plugging this in, look up the process for resetting your airbag light on your Nissan. It takes 2 minutes and anyone can do it. It's just a matter of turning the key on and off several times at the correct intervals.

Thank you so much for creating these. The Nissa dealership quoted me $2,400 to fix my 2008 Nissan Rogue because my VIN was not included in the recall. This is a severe issue. Bypassing the broken part with this device will now always arm the airbag, which is a lot safer than the defective part not allowing the airbag to be armed. Thanks for saving the day airbag360!

Side note: first plug in the device (plug and play under the seat) and then use a diagnostic tool to clear the airbag code. Turn the car off then back on, and the dash & passenger airbag off light will disappear.

The sensor cleared the passenger airbag light as expected! Only thing is the passenger seat belt light stays on because with the sensor the computer thinks someone is sitting in passenger seat. 3 options. You leave it on so you know passenger needs to put on seatbelt, or buckle it when none is sitting there or disconnect sensor.
